Output 07599888f722c2691e51145a304f055064d351828405c9b4456a55ac143cd867:2

value
107301566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a6a5f735f6cc0b369b7e0ae8ece2cfb6930828a OP_EQUAL
address
MAJqELHLhYTvm8nRqwR7J2upBj9p9DdoCq
transaction
07599888f722c2691e51145a304f055064d351828405c9b4456a55ac143cd867
spent
true